Stoicism takes its name from the location where its founder, Zeno of Citium (Cyprus), customarily lectured—the Stoa Poikile (Painted Colonnade). Zeno, who flourished from the early 3rd century bce, showed in his own doctrines the impact of before Greek attitudes, notably People described previously mentioned. He was apparently well versed in Platonic imagined, for he had examined at Plato’s Academy both equally with Xenocrates of Chalcedon and with Polemon of Athens, successive heads on the Academy. Zeno was responsible for the division of philosophy into a few sections: logic, physics, and ethics. He also proven the central Stoic doctrines in each aspect, to ensure later Stoics were being to develop instead of to vary radically the views of the founder. With some exceptions (in the field of logic), Zeno Hence furnished the next themes as being the important framework of Stoic philosophy: logic being an instrument instead of being an close in alone; human happiness as an item of everyday living Based on nature; physical concept as delivering the indicates by which proper actions are to get established; perception as The idea of sure knowledge; the clever particular person given that the design of human excellence; Platonic forms—the summary entities wherein factors of precisely the same genus “take part”—as currently being unreal; true knowledge as generally accompanied by assent; the fundamental compound of all existing items as remaining a divine hearth, the common ideas of which happen to be (1) passive (subject) and (2) Energetic (reason inherent in subject); belief in a very planet conflagration and renewal; belief from the corporeality of all matters; belief inside the fated causality that always binds all things; cosmopolitanism, or cultural outlook transcending narrower loyalties; as well as the obligation, or responsibility, to choose only Those people functions which can be in accord with nature, all other functions currently being a make any difference of indifference.

Now we have witnessed that the Stoics held that at start the soul is free of experiential information. The Stoics, on the more info other hand, didn't hold that this excluded the possibility that we're born with innate features and psychological impulses. The most elementary impulse located in new-born creatures will be the impulse toward self-preservation. This can be the key human impulse as well as starting point of Stoic ethics. This impulse is implanted by Nature and entails a certain consciousness of issues proper to (or belonging to) the organism and of points alien or hostile into the creature.
